## Step 4: Digest Scheduler Migration

Move digest scheduling from cron to the Saltmere queue. Export existing schedules from `email_digests`, transform cadence values to ISO durations, and load into `digest_jobs`. Disable the old cron entry only after verifying the first queue-driven run. Backfill skipped digests manually if the cutover window exceeds one hour. Run the migration script against the scheduler database using the connection string below.

replica DSN, kajep-yahag: mssql://praok_svc:iF@db-8d68.plorvaio.local:5432/eliion

ALERT: StageView Seat-Map Renderer Degraded

Heads up — the seat-map renderer for the Orpheum Lane theatre client is timing out on venues with more than 800 seats. Customers see a spinner instead of the map, so checkout conversions are tanking. It started right after the 4.2 canvas refactor, so hold the rollout train until we bisect. Rolling back the renderer pod usually clears it within minutes. If you need a decision on shipping tonight, reach the rendering crew here.

escalation mailbox, hadug-bajog: sormir@norvalabs.internal

Q: Why do builds on the Pinwheel CI fleet sometimes fail with "artifact from the future" errors?

A: Classic clock skew. A few of the older Marrowgate build agents drift several seconds per day, and the artifact signer refuses timestamps ahead of its own clock. First, ask the requester to retry — the sync daemon usually catches up. If it keeps happening, you'll need to unlock the agent's time-sync console, which requires the recovery passphrase given below.

unlock words, yawig-kagef: gordor-holvan-ulaael-pramir-ulaiel-tamdor